Python是一種高級編程語言,廣泛用于數(shù)據(jù)處理和科學(xué)計算。文本存儲是Python在數(shù)據(jù)處理和文件IO方面的重要應(yīng)用,讓我們看一下如何使用Python實現(xiàn)文本存儲。
在Python中,可以使用內(nèi)置模塊open()來打開一個文件并且讀取/寫入其中的內(nèi)容。例如,要讀取一個名為"example.txt"的文本文件,并將其每行作為一個字符串存儲到列表中,可以使用以下代碼:
file = open("example.txt", "r") content = file.readlines() file.close() print(content)
在這里,我們使用了open()函數(shù)以只讀模式(r)打開了"example.txt"文件。我們?nèi)缓笫褂胷eadlines()方法來讀取文件內(nèi)容,并將其存儲為一個列表。最后,我們使用close()方法關(guān)閉文件句柄。
現(xiàn)在,如果我們想要將一個列表中的內(nèi)容寫入文件,可以使用以下代碼:
content = ["Hello", "World", "!"] file = open("example.txt", "w") file.write("\n".join(content)) file.close()
在這里,我們使用了open()函數(shù)以寫入模式(w)打開了"example.txt"文件。我們將多行文本存儲在一個列表中,并使用"\n"連接符將其連接成一個字符串。最后,我們使用write()方法將字符串寫入到文件中,并使用close()方法關(guān)閉文件句柄。
總的來說,Python提供了簡便的方法來進行文本存儲操作。無論是讀取還是寫入,Python的內(nèi)置open()函數(shù)和相應(yīng)的方法提供了簡單易用的接口,使得文本存儲非常容易。
上一篇vue $el.
下一篇c json字符串中取值